Transaction 95bedf262429975e2fd2c708e2ff677c5917d4a85ea74fad7df0562911f17891

2 Input
2 Outputs
  • 95bedf262429975e2fd2c708e2ff677c5917d4a85ea74fad7df0562911f17891:0
  • value  19646381
    address  bc1q2ql4rlzuy725nyhnfkfewlgfj5mr47h90qvt8d
  • 95bedf262429975e2fd2c708e2ff677c5917d4a85ea74fad7df0562911f17891:1
  • value  3580379
    address  3Cpecsi5jTiFj5m298RDnyNiDpcfV8rNT9